Charlies first fishing session 22-09-2013

Today was my lads first fishing trip. Charlie is only three and has been wanting to go fishing for quite a while now. I took him to my local syndicate where I have been doing most of fishing this year. The lake is ideal as its full of Roach plus has Bream, Rudd and Tench all running to specimen sizes. Its was a nice day with the sun shining and a light breeze on the lake. As soon as we got out the car to look at the lake Charlie was jumping with joy to see the lake, we could see the Roach topping on the other bank just where the breeze was catching the water. I did put a couple of rods out on the far margin to try get a quick bite. We both sat and set the rod up Charlie helping to put the line through the eyes of the rod and thread the float on. I cast out quickly to check the weight was correct and the float just disappeared, I thought the weight was wrong until I lifted the rod up with a small Roach on the end. It had taken just the hook this was a great start the Roach were hungry and we had a pint of Marukyu Krilled Maggots to fill them up on. Things could not of gone better as soon as the float hit the water it righted itself and was then pulled straight under by Charlie`s first Roach.


His face light up while he was reeling it in and when he pulled it out the water there was big “I got one daddy” to say I was a proud father was an understatement. We carried on fishing with Charlie catching around 20 fish and each time his face was a picture. I was also very pleased he held all the fish he caught for a photo and gives a cheeky smile for the camera.


We had been fishing for around an hour and half when I got a call off the missus to come home as Charlie`s nannar was on her way. I did think he might get bored after a couple so I was over the moon he enjoyed it.




We packed up and Charlie feed the rest of the Krilled Maggots to the Roach using the catapult which he was very good with. I look forward to taking him again and it will be Ella`s turn next year. I cant wait the future of fishing is here....
